About

Masoud Haghani is a scholar working on Neurology, Cellular and Molecular Neuroscience and Molecular Biology. According to data from OpenAlex, Masoud Haghani has authored 41 papers receiving a total of 804 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Neurology, 14 papers in Cellular and Molecular Neuroscience and 7 papers in Molecular Biology. Recurrent topics in Masoud Haghani’s work include Neuroinflammation and Neurodegeneration Mechanisms (13 papers), Neuroscience and Neuropharmacology Research (12 papers) and Neurological Disease Mechanisms and Treatments (9 papers). Masoud Haghani is often cited by papers focused on Neuroinflammation and Neurodegeneration Mechanisms (13 papers), Neuroscience and Neuropharmacology Research (12 papers) and Neurological Disease Mechanisms and Treatments (9 papers). Masoud Haghani collaborates with scholars based in Iran, United States and Denmark. Masoud Haghani's co-authors include Mohammad Shabani, Mahnaz Bayat, Seyed Mostafa Shid Moosavi, Mahyar Janahmadi, Ali Rafati, Mohammad Reza Namavar, Kasra Moazzami, Fereshteh Motamedi, Mohammad Javan and Afshin Borhani‐Haghighi and has published in prestigious journals such as PLoS ONE, Brain Research and Neuroscience.
